On 11/20/25 the National Institutes of Health forecasted grant opportunity RFA-AG-26-021 for Mechanisms Underlying Olfactory Dysfunction in Aging and Alzheimer’s Disease and Alzheimer’s Disease-Related Dementias.
The grant will be issued under grant program 93.866 Aging Research.
